Subject: Pagination change in Quillport API v4

Plugin authors: cursor-based pagination replaces page/offset params in v4. Old params return 410 starting next cycle. Use the next_cursor field from each response; limits cap at 200 items. Test against the Quillport sandbox before the cutover. The reference token for the canary build appears below.

pipeline stamp: htk31_f769b577b3028a4e9958e5bb8d1259a

// Heads up: before this client ships anything to Packrat (our telemetry
// collector), payloads get gzipped and batched in 64KB chunks. Don't skip
// compression — the Flintvale ingest nodes reject raw bodies over 8KB and
// you'll just see cryptic 413s. Batching is handled by the Squishline
// middleware, so you only need to wire up the client here. One gotcha:
// retries reuse the compressed buffer, so don't mutate it. The client
// authenticates with the internal key on the next line.

API key for yahig-tadup: kto7_ubizbYm

- [ ] Step 7: Archive cold storage buckets (Glacierline tier). Confirm both ceremony witnesses are present, verify bucket manifests match the Oxbow ledger, then seal the archive key shares. Plugin authors may observe but not handle shares. Once sealed, the archive index itself is encrypted and can only be reopened with the passphrase below.

vault phrase of badup-hahig = tamael-aldael-kelmir-istael-fenok-istwyn-tamius-jorath-oliion

Reviewer notes: this release changes several defaults for the rate-parity checker used by the Hollowbrook hotel group. Crawl intervals drop from hourly to every 20 minutes, stale-rate tolerance tightens from 48h to 12h, and mismatch alerts now fire on a 2% delta instead of 5%. Operators who relied on the looser thresholds must pin the old values explicitly. Regression coverage was extended in `parity/defaults_test`. The new default configuration shipped with this release is reproduced in full below.

deployment values, badug-baduf:
eliir:
  pin: 2702
  tenant: fraiel
  seal: seal_c7100bc2
  metrics_host: metrics.eliir.plorvasoft.test
  standby_team: queneth
  escalation: norwyn-rusdor
  nonce: 73932f